FAQs about the Greek Islands Ferry Route Map
Q: Do I need to book ferry tickets in advance?
A: It's recommended to book your ferry tickets in advance, especially during peak season. You can book online or at a local travel agency.
Q: How long should I spend on each island?
A: It depends on your interests and how much time you have. Generally, 2-3 days per island is a good amount of time to explore and soak up the local culture.
Q: Are there any islands that are off-limits to tourists?
A: There are a few islands that are off-limits to tourists due to their status as protected nature reserves. It's important to respect these restrictions and not attempt to visit these islands.
Q: Can I bring my car on the ferry?
A: Yes, you can bring your car on the ferry, but it's recommended to book in advance as space is limited.
